#ccd652 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ccd652 is composed of 80% red, 83.9% green and 32.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 4.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 61.7% yellow and 16.1% black. It has a hue angle of 64.5 degrees, a saturation of 61.7% and a lightness of 58%. #ccd652 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ffa4 with #99ad00. Closest websafe color is: #cccc66.

Shades and Tints of #ccd652
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010100 is the darkest color, while #fbfcf1 is the lightest one.

Tones of #ccd652
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#949494 is the less saturated color, while #e8f731 is the most saturated one.
